The three winning entries from the 53 were announced and Ibrahim Saleh handed out the prizes to the winners. Ibrahim Saleh explained that the Photography Exhibition was C[pounds sterling]one of the many innovative initiatives launched by the Dubai Shopping Festival Office in 2005 as one of the mega events of Dubai Summer Surprises, with the aim of celebrating and honouring talents both locally and globally.C[yen] C[pounds sterling]The Photography Exhibition is tailored to celebrate the talents of junior and professional photographers alike. This yearCOs exhibition witnessed the largest scope of applicants since its inception with around 100 applicants coming from around the globe,C[yen] he added. Abdul Nasser, from India, was announced as the winner of the Photography Exhibition for his image of a desert Bedouin captured in black and white. The Photography Exhibition this year was the fourth such edition organised during DSS and one among the Signature Events in 2008. Since its inception, the final day of the Photography Exhibition has been organised to coincide with the World Photography Day which is held every year to honour the efforts of photographers worldwide.
